我使用的是PostgreSQL8.4,并且已经将数据库编码设置为UTF8,并将POSIX设置为排序规则和字符类型。如果我在pgadmin3下运行,这个查询是可以的,但是如果我在PHP中执行,就会出现错误。"Internal Server Error: SQLSTATE[22021]:invalidbytesequencefo
我正在使用Symfony 2.3和PostgreSQL 9.2。我只想根据复选框的值执行两个简单的查询。我知道在理论中ILIKE是不存在的,我应该使用较低的函数。但是,如果我在查询中指定了一些特殊字符(例如“è”),则在使用不区分大小写的版本(即使用for函数时)时会出现错误。特别是,我得到的错误如下:
SQLSTATE[22021]: Character not in repertoire: 7
最近,当我尝试在数据库中插入一些俄语西里尔文文本时遇到了一些问题。我使用的是框架symfony2,我使用的是Doctrine ORM和一个Nginx web服务器。数据库是一个PostgreSql。当我尝试在列中插入俄语文本时,有时会发生问题,我得到一个500 Internal Server错误,并显示以下消息:
SQLSTATE[22021]: Character not in repertoire: 7 ERREUR: invalid</e
如何使用Django的对象关系映射和PostgreSQL后端来存储二进制数据的"blob“?是的,我知道Django不喜欢这种事情,是的,我知道他们更喜欢你使用ImageField或FileField,但我可以说,这对我的应用程序来说是不切实际的。我尝试过使用TextField破解它,但当我的二进制数据不严格符合models编码类型(默认情况下是unicode )时,我有时会遇到错误。例如:
psycopg2.DataError: i
我希望使用SessionServiceProvider和PdoSessionHandler将会话存储在数据库中,但是当我尝试使用测试帐户登录时,会话将写入数据库中,但登录操作不正确,因此我会在循环中获得登录页面另外,我在错误日志中得到了以下错误
Uncaught exception 'PDOException' with message 'SQLSTATE[22021]: Character not in repertoi